According to the former president, the 2024 election will be the most significant in American history.

According to former US President Donald Trump, reelection would be the nation’s last chance to reverse its precipitous slide.

“Our nation is headed for disaster. In an interview with journalist Megyn Kelly for the SiriusXM satellite radio channel, which aired on Thursday, President Trump declared that “Our country is going down.”

He declared that the 2024 presidential election is “the most significant election we’ve ever had” because the US “has one last chance.”

The former president confessed that he had made a similar claim regarding his 2016 presidential victory, but claimed that the election the next year would be even more significant.

Under the Biden administration, he asserted, “Our country is going bad, our country is being destroyed” and added, “We’re a nation in serious decline, and I think I can turn it around very fast.”

Kelly questioned Trump’s level of fear on the possibility of going to jail given that he is now charged in four different cases.

The Republican candidate responded, “I have a terrific attitude, it doesn’t impact me at all because I’m fighting for the country, I’m fighting for the people.

The 77-year-old claimed that because the public is aware that the accusations are “false,” the “good” polling results give him confidence that he will “win the election regardless of what happens.”

According to a survey released on Wednesday by Quinnipiac University, 62% of Republican voters want Trump to be their party’s nominee in 2024. The poll also revealed that Trump currently trails Joe Biden, the sitting president, by just 1%.

Advertisements

Trump reaffirmed his prior assertion that he doesn’t think Biden will run for office again in 2024 because of the 80-year-old’s ostensibly declining health.

He remarked of Biden, “I watched him yesterday, he couldn’t put two phrases [together], he can’t talk. “It’s a competence thing, not an age thing.”

In an August Wall Street Journal poll, 73% of US voters said they believed Biden was too elderly to run for re-election, while only 36% said he was mentally capable of carrying out his duties.

Trump’s age, which is just three years younger than Biden’s, is reportedly a concern for many Americans as well. According to a June NBC survey, 55% of respondents were worried about his physical and mental wellbeing.
